精品丰满熟女一区二区三区_五月天亚洲欧美综合网_亚洲青青青在线观看_国产一区二区精选

  • <menu id="29e66"></menu>

    <bdo id="29e66"><mark id="29e66"><legend id="29e66"></legend></mark></bdo>

  • <pre id="29e66"><tt id="29e66"><rt id="29e66"></rt></tt></pre>

      <label id="29e66"></label><address id="29e66"><mark id="29e66"><strike id="29e66"></strike></mark></address>
      學(xué)習啦>學(xué)習電腦>電腦硬件知識>鍵盤鼠標>

      怎么用js來控制鍵盤

      時間: 沈迪豪908 分享

        剛接觸js的小伙伴可能對js怎么樣操作鍵盤比較感興趣,這篇文章主要介紹了利用js來控制鍵盤的上下左右鍵示例代碼。需要的朋友可以過來參考下,希望對大家有所幫助

        js來控制鍵盤的上下左右鍵

        這是一個JS初級代碼,想學(xué)JS的朋友,可以研究下或者擴展下

        具體代碼如下:

        代碼如下:

        <style>

        tr.highlight{background:#08246B;color:white;}

        </style>

        <table border="1" width="70%" id="ice">

        <tr>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        </tr>

        <tr>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        </tr>

        <tr>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        </tr>

        <tr>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        </tr>

        <tr>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        <td><input type='text'></td>

        </tr>

        </table>

        <script language="javascript">

        <!--

        //定義初始化行列

        var currentLine=-1;

        var currentCol=-1;

        document.onkeydown=function(e){

        e=window.event||e;

        switch(e.keyCode){

        case 37: //左鍵

        currentCol--;

        changeItem();

        break;

        case 38: //向上鍵

        currentLine--;

        changeItem();

        break;

        case 39: //右鍵

        currentCol++;

        changeItem();

        break;

        case 40: //向下鍵

        currentLine++;

        changeItem();

        break;

        default:

        break;

        }

        }

        //方向鍵調(diào)用

        function changeItem(){

        if(document.all)

        var it=document.getElementByIdx_x("ice").children[0];

        else

        var it=document.getElementByIdx_x("ice");

        for(i=0;i<it.rows.length;i++){

        it.rows[i].className="";

        }

        if(currentLine<0){

        currentLine=it.rows.length-1;

        }

        if(currentLine==it.rows.length){

        currentLine=0;

        }

        var objtab=document.all.ice;

        var objrow=objtab.rows[currentLine].getElementsByTagName_r("INPUT");

        if(currentCol<0){

        currentCol=objrow.length-1;

        }else if(currentCol==objrow.length){

        currentCol=0;

        }

        objrow[currentCol].select();

        //調(diào)試使用

        it.rows[currentLine].className="highlight";

        }

        //-->

        </script>

      js控制鍵盤相關(guān)文章:

      1.鍵盤怎么控制鼠標移動

      2.怎么用鍵盤控制鼠標移動

      3.XP系統(tǒng)在哪里設(shè)置鍵盤控制鼠標

      4.win8的電腦怎么用鍵盤控制鼠標

      5.鼠標箭頭不好控制該怎么辦

      怎么用js來控制鍵盤

      剛接觸js的小伙伴可能對js怎么樣操作鍵盤比較感興趣,這篇文章主要介紹了利用js來控制鍵盤的上下左右鍵示例代碼。需要的朋友可以過來參考下,希望對大家有所幫助 js來控制鍵盤的上下左右鍵 這是一個JS初級代碼,想學(xué)JS的朋友,可以研究
      推薦度:
      點擊下載文檔文檔為doc格式

      精選文章

      • 電腦鍵盤詳細示意圖
        電腦鍵盤詳細示意圖

        電腦鍵盤作為電腦最常用輸入設(shè)備,其重要性就不言而喻了,可能很多新手都不知道鍵位在哪?今天學(xué)習啦為大家分享一下鍵盤的基本知識以及鍵位的詳細

      • 什么牌子的機械鍵盤好
        什么牌子的機械鍵盤好

        愛玩游戲的小伙伴們,可能都玩過LOL,都喜歡用好的鍵盤,而機械鍵盤就是不二之選,這時候就有一個問題,機械鍵盤什么牌子好?下面由學(xué)下啦小編為大家

      • 機械鍵盤跟普通鍵盤的不同之處
        機械鍵盤跟普通鍵盤的不同之處

        愛玩游戲的小伙伴們,可能都喜歡用機械鍵盤,但是你知道跟普通鍵盤有什么不一樣?不知道的話跟著學(xué)習啦小編一起來了解一下機械鍵盤跟普通鍵盤的區(qū)別

      • 教你怎么清洗鍵盤
        教你怎么清洗鍵盤

        大家都知道鍵盤怎么用但是永久了鍵盤會很臟,這時候我們都會想到電腦鍵盤怎么清洗呢?不知道的話跟著學(xué)習啦小編一起來學(xué)習一下鍵盤該怎么清洗吧。

      1936484